What is a Private Psychiatrist?
A private psychiatrist is a medical doctor concentrating on the diagnosis and treatment of mental health conditions. Unlike their equivalents in the National Health Service (NHS), private psychiatrists operate in the private healthcare system, which typically allows for greater versatility, customized care, and reduced waiting times. They usually have a broad variety of proficiency, including however not restricted to stress and anxiety conditions, depression, personality conditions, and addictions.

FAQs About Private Psychiatry in the UK
Q1: How much does a private psychiatrist expense?

Private psychiatry expenses vary depending on place, experience, and specialty. Preliminary consultations [can you see a psychiatrist privately](http://152.42.207.183:3000/private-psychiatrist-uk01864574) range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500, while follow-up appointments may cost between ₤ 100 to ₤ 250.

Q2: Is it possible to get a recommendation to a private psychiatrist through the NHS?

While the NHS typically does not offer direct recommendations to private psychiatrists, you may speak with your NHS general professional (GP) about your desire for private care, which might help you find an appropriate alternative.

Q3: What kind of treatment can I anticipate from a private psychiatrist?

Treatment plans are individually customized and might include medication management, psychotherapy, way of life modifications, and follow-up care.

Q4: How long does treatment generally last?

The duration of treatment differs considerably and depends upon the intricacy of the mental health condition, individual development, and objectives set during the initial assessment.

Q5: Can I switch psychiatrists if I am not satisfied with the treatment?

Yes, clients can seek a various psychiatrist if they feel their requirements are not being met.
